Rose Gregersen is a human[1]. She worked as an aquatic ecologist[2].

- Rose Gregersen's academic thesis is recorded as The response of stream ecosystem function to acid mine drainage remediation[14].
- Rose Gregersen's academic thesis is recorded as Addressing the challenges to understanding long-term lake change driven by anthropogenic impacts[15].
